oil pump and 'O' rings 200 1991

There is no need to drop the cross member.
1) Put jack under pan, release mounts, lift engine as high as possible
2) sling engine from stout baulk of timber across the wings (protect with blankets)
3) Remove jack
4) Remove left hand mounting bracket
5) Undo nuts, release pan, turn through 90 degrees
6) If it still won't drop because an internal baffle catches on the oil pump, undo two oil pump bolts and drop it.
7) Cut away baffle plate a bit so that it will clear oil pump on reassembly, or else cut and bend it straight again after the pan has cleared the pump.
8)Check clearances in the pump are up to spec. replace, with new o-rings.
9) Refit pan, reverse procedure.

It took me, working it out for myself, about 2 hours. An experienced mechanic ? About an hour at most.
